Comprehending the Ignition System
Before delving into repairs, it's crucial to comprehend the elements of the ignition system. The Ignition Repair Near Me system is accountable for producing the stimulate necessary to fire up the fuel-air mix in the engine's cylinders. Here are the main parts involved:
- Ignition Coil: Converts battery voltage to the high voltage required to create a trigger.
- Spark Plug: Creates the trigger that ignites the fuel and air mix.
- Distributor Cap and Rotor: Routes the electrical present to the right cylinder.
- Ignition Switch: Provides power to the ignition system when the key is turned.
- Circuitry and Connectors: Transmit electrical existing in between elements.
Typical Ignition Problems
Here are some common signs of ignition issues:
- Engine Cranks But Doesn't Start: Indicates that there may be an issue with the trigger or sustain supply.
- No Crank at All: Often points to an issue with the battery, starter, or ignition switch.
- Periodic Starting Issues: Suggests a failing ignition module or a connection problem.
- Inspect Engine Light On: May indicate a fault within the ignition system.
Identifying the Problem
Identifying ignition issues typically requires an organized approach. Follow this detailed guide to identify the root cause of your ignition problems:
Step 1: Check the Battery
- Examine Battery Connections: Ensure that the battery terminals are clean and tight.
- Test Battery Voltage: Use a multimeter to examine if the battery is providing sufficient voltage (usually 12.6 volts).
Step 2: Inspect the Ignition Switch
- Turn Key to Different Positions: If the engine does not crank, the ignition switch might be faulty.
- Test for Voltage Output: Use a multimeter to look for voltage at the starter or ignition coil when turning the key.
Action 3: Examine the Ignition Coil
- Visual Inspection: Look for any signs of damage or corrosion.
- Testing the Coil: Use an ohmmeter to determine the resistance; compare the readings with the producer's specifications.

Frequently Asked Questions about Car Ignition Issues
Q1: What are the signs of a stopping working ignition coil?
A1: Common signs consist of difficulty starting the automobile, bad velocity, and engine misfires.
Q2: Can I drive with a malfunctioning ignition switch?
A2: It is not suggested to drive with a defective ignition switch. It can cause finish engine failure and increase your danger of mishaps.
Q3: How frequently should I replace trigger plugs?
A3: Spark plugs should normally be changed every 30,000 to 50,000 miles, however always refer to your vehicle's owner's handbook.
Q4: What should I do if my engine won't start after replacing elements?
A4: If the engine still will not start, it may be needed to inspect other systems, including fuel shipment and the starter motor.
